“The most beautiful pier in England” Sir John Betjeman. Clevedon Pier is England’s only Grade 1 listed pier and celebrated its 150th anniversary in 2019. Clevedon Pier was opened in 1869 to receive paddle steamer passengers from Devon and Wales. Today it is a focal point for events in Clevedon and […]

One of the few historical pageants left in the United Kingdom the performance is a spectacular re-enactment celebrating 2,000 years of Axbridge history from Saxon times to the present day. First performed in 1967 the Axbridge Pageant was such a success it was decided to repeat and since then has […]
